Anthony Astringent Oil Control Toner Pads has a lower comedogenic rating, making it the safer pick for acne-prone skin. Anthony All Purpose Facial Moisturiser scores lower on irritancy, which may suit sensitive skin better. Both products share 10 ingredients in common. Anthony All Purpose Facial Moisturiser has 48 unique ingredients while Anthony Astringent Oil Control Toner Pads has 23.
